Understanding the Types of Driving Licenses in Portugal
Before starting the journey to acquire a driving license, it’s vital to understand the various types offered. Portugal acknowledges numerous categories of driving licenses, each customized to specific vehicle types and user needs. Below is a simplified table detailing the most common driving license categories in Portugal.

Browsing the procedure to get a Portuguese driving license includes numerous actions. Below is an organized list of the necessary steps to improve your journey:
Gather Required Documents:
Valid identification (passport/ID card)Residency proof (utility costs or rental contract)Medical certificateTwo recent passport-sized imagesTax Identification Number (NIF)
Enroll in a Driving School:
Choose a licensed driving school for instruction and assistance.Take part in theoretical and practical lessons to prepare for the examinations.
Take the Theoretical Exam:
Study the Portuguese Highway Code and traffic guidelines.Pass a multiple-choice test on roadway indications, legislation, and driving strategies.
Complete Practical Lessons:
Undergo useful driving lessons with an instructor.
Pass the Practical Driving Test:
Demonstrate driving skills in a real-world environment to an inspector.
Submit the Application:
Once you’ve passed both exams, send your application at the Instituto da Mobilidade e dos Transportes (IMT) with all required documents.
Receive Your License:

Yes, you can drive in Portugal with a foreign license for up to 185 days after ending up being a local. After that, you require to exchange it for a Portuguese license.
2. Is a medical certificate necessary?
Yes, a medical certificate validating your fitness to drive is needed when obtaining a license.
